Uncanny X-Men #456 by Goodnight |
We left the X-Men last time being watched by some lizard creatures. The X-Men had come directly from Spain after receiving an emergency beacon from Wolverine's plane. Wolverine was helping and old friend Mary McKenna when they and the stowaway X23 were attacked by the lizards. Once they arrive, they find Mary dead, X23 crazed and wolverine nowhere to be found. We begin #456 with the lizards attacking the X-Men but are quickly fooled by a Marvel Girl trick. Marvel Girl searches one of there minds to find they are evolved from dinosaurs that call themselves the Hauk'ka, being fooled they call for backup. We then jump to the blackbird where Psylocke is locked up and doing some soul searching. Back to the fight, here comes backup, three super powered lizard guys, one a telepath. The fight rages until the telepath takes over Marvel Girls mind, she in turn takes out Storm, the only X-Men that was making headway against the lizards, thereby killing the X-Men’s chances. They are all taken hostage and taken away, except X-23, she got away and headed back to the blackbird to release Psylocke. Psylocke free takes out some left over lizards and her and X23 are off to save the rest of the team. Another
great X-Men. Lots of action, great fight scenes and great art. It is
a well put together storyline so far. The one negative is this, I hate
when they put a character on the cover who is not even in the book,
a great cover of Wolverine and only one picture of him in the whole
comic. This has been a good series thus far and am definitely looking
forward to the conclusion.
